Abstract
This paper presents a planning-based approach for the enumeration of alternative data-centric workflows specified in ASASEL (Abstract State mAchineS Execution Language), which define the coordination of data and computation services for satisfying data requirements. The optimization of data-centric workflows is associated to the exploration of the parallelization of the workflow activities. We address the exploration of parallelism formalizing the enumeration problem in the DLV-K language. Together, our ASASEL language and enactment engine along with our enumeration approach provide the foundation for a highly flexible mechanism for managing data-centric workflows.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
References
Calvanese, D., De Giacomo, G., Lenzerini, M., Mecella, M., Patrizi, F.: Automatic service composition and synthesis: the roman model. IEEE Data Eng. Bull. 31(3), 18–22 (2008)
Cuevas-Vicenttín, V.: Evaluation of hybrid queries based on service coordination. Ph.D. thesis, University of Grenoble, May 2005. http://tel.archives-ouvertes.fr/tel-00630601
Cuevas-Vicenttín, V., Vargas-Solar, G., Collet, C., Ibrahim, N., Bobineau, C.: Coordinating services for accessing and processing data in dynamic environments. In: Meersman, R., Dillon, T.S., Herrero, P. (eds.) OTM 2010. LNCS, vol. 6426, pp. 309–325. Springer, Heidelberg (2010)
Curcin, V., Missier, P., De Roure, D.: Simulating taverna workflows using stochastic process algebras. Concurr. Comput. : Pract. Exper. 23(16), 1920–1935 (2011)
Gurevich, Y.: Evolving Algebras 1993: Lipari Guide. In: Specification and Validation Methods, pp. 9–36. Oxford University Press Inc., New York (1995)
Hidders, J., Kwasnikowska, N., Sroka, J., Tyszkiewicz, J., Van den Bussche, J.: Dfl: A dataflow language based on petri nets and nested relational calculus. Inf. Syst. 33(3), 261–284 (2008)
McIlraith, S.A., Son, T.C.: Adapting golog for composition of semantic web services. In: Proceedings of the Eights International Conference on Principles and Knowledge Representation and Reasoning (KR 2002), 22–25 April, 2002, Toulouse, France, pp. 482–496 (2002)
Ogasawara, E.S., de Oliveira, D., Valduriez, P., Dias, J., Porto, F., Mattoso, M.: An algebraic approach for data-centric scientific workflows. PVLDB 4(12), 1328–1339 (2011)
Sirin, E., Parsia, B., Wu, D., Hendler, J., Nau, D.: Htn planning for web service composition using shop2. Web Semant. 1(4), 377–396 (2004)
Srivastava, U., Munagala, K., Widom, J., Motwani, R.: Query optimization over web services. In: Proceedings of the 32nd International Conference on Very Large Data Bases, VLDB 2006, pp. 355–366. VLDB Endowment (2006)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2015 Springer International Publishing Switzerland
About this paper
Cite this paper
López-Enríquez, CM., Cuevas-Vicenttín, V., Vargas-Solar, G., Collet, C., Zechinelli-Martini, JL. (2015). A Planning-Based Service Composition Approach for Data-Centric Workflows. In: Toumani, F., et al. Service-Oriented Computing - ICSOC 2014 Workshops. Lecture Notes in Computer Science(), vol 8954. Springer, Cham. https://doi.org/10.1007/978-3-319-22885-3_12
Download citation
DOI: https://doi.org/10.1007/978-3-319-22885-3_12
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-22884-6
Online ISBN: 978-3-319-22885-3
eBook Packages: Computer ScienceComputer Science (R0)